Angiosperms, also called flowering plants, have seeds that are enclosed within an ovary (usually a fruit), while gymnosperms have no flowers or fruits, and have unenclosed or “naked” seeds on the surface of scales or leaves.

Non-vascular Plants No xylem and phloem (no roots/stems/leaves), gametophyte is dominant in alternation of generations life cycle, sporophyte generation dependant on gametophyte, water is needed for reproduction, dispersal of species by spores.

Unlike angiosperms, non-vascular plants do not produce flowers, fruit, or seeds.They also lack true leaves, roots, and stems.
